No Worries Just Trust in Christ Moment by Moment

When I hear believers warning other believers to "be careful" I say; "trust the Holy Spirit, when we do this we need not worry, He tells us what we need when we need it, no need to worry about our response.
Mark 13:11 "And when they arrest you and hand you over, do not worry beforehand about what you are to say, but say whatever is given you at that time; for you are not the ones speaking, but it is the Holy Spirit."
We need to diligently know the Word of God. When we know the Word of God and depend on the Holy Spirit we will know false doctrine when it waltzes in front of us.
Philippians 1:9-10
“And this is my prayer: that your love may abound more and more in knowledge and depth of insight, so that you may be able to discern what is best and may be pure and blameless for the day of Christ.”
We don't have to figure out what to say or worry about what is truth, Christ in us gives us all the tools to know when we need it.
1 Corinthians 2:14
“The person without the Spirit does not accept the things that come from the Spirit of God but considers them foolishness, and cannot understand them because they are discerned only through the Spirit.”
Hebrews 5:14
“But solid food is for the mature, who by constant use have trained themselves to distinguish good from evil.”
James 1:5
“If any of you lacks wisdom, you should ask God, who gives generously to all without finding fault, and it will be given to you.”
When we try to figure things out on our own to be prepared we are not trusting the Holy Spirit. The best and only preparation for everything is knowing the Scriptures and seeking Christ.
Proverbs 2:3-5
“Indeed, if you call out for insight and cry aloud for understanding, and if you look for it as for silver and search for it as for hidden treasure, then you will understand the fear of the LORD and find the knowledge of God.”
